Work and Play, Ep 5: The Happiness Gap and Getting Macronutrients Right Mona reflects on her son’s high school graduation and uses it to introduce the “happiness gap” many high achievers feel when accomplishments don’t deliver lasting satisfaction. She explains the hedonic treadmill and Arthur Brooks’ idea of the striver’s curse: dopamine fuels the chase, not the arrival, so the baseline resets and the next goal shows up fast—often leaving people depleted. Using weight loss and sustainable habits as an example, Mona shares how the nervous system can link safety and worth to achievement, making standing still feel unsafe.
